Recap of the 2022 ATVBC AGM and Jamboree in Valemount
The ATVBC Annual AGM & Jamboree was a big success as we brought our event to a new part of the province that ATVBC has not explored in the past.
Headed up by Ralph Matthews and the AGM Planning Committee, our members were treated to a week of daily rides, nightly campfire socials, an ice cream parade, BBQ dinner, wine & cheese social and sunset rides that take your breathe away!
While the local area currently doesn’t have an ATV club, there is an incredible variety of riding and local enthusiasts eager to share their terrain. From August 2-8th, over 85+ riders descended on the community of Valemount to explore the amazing trails and landscape. Daily rides saw our members reaching new heights including the incredible 8500ft climb to the top of Canoe Mountain. After a day of riding and exploring on Friday night our members were treated to a BBQ dinner hosted by local business BBQ Banditos. Saturday night we held our AGM along with our silent auction and wine & cheese social. The food was amazing, and the beer provided by the local brewery was a big hit. Special thanks to those members who put their names forward to volunteer on the ATVBC board of directors.
Congratulations to all the nominees and a special welcome to our new board members. For the first time many years, the ATVBC Board is at full capacity with 15 board members.
